DC just announced three new Tales From the Dark Multiverse one-shots:
War of the Gods by Vita Ayala & Ariel Olivetti
Crisis on Infinite Earths by Steve Orlando & Mike Perkins
Dark Nights Metal by Collin Kelly, Jackson Lanzing, Scott Snyder & Karl Mostert and Trevor Scott

Swamp Thing #61: On a planet of sentient plants, Swamp Thing is inherently ‘the horror.’ And it’s up to a grieving and aged Green Lantern to handle his arrival...it all makes for a great issue and one of the better Green Lantern comics I’ve read of late. #SwampedThing
